Which of the following refers to the mixing and blending of many people from different cultures who are involved in a like activity or setting?

Cultural diversity refers to the presence of various cultural groups within a society or a specific setting, where individuals from different backgrounds, traditions, languages, and practices come together and engage in common activities or interests. This concept emphasizes the richness that diverse cultures bring when they interact, share experiences, and blend their perspectives, contributing to a more vibrant and dynamic community.

In the context of mixing and blending of individuals from different cultures, cultural diversity highlights the importance of appreciating and valuing these differences while allowing for collaboration and mutual respect. This blending can lead to innovative ideas, solutions to problems, and a deeper understanding of one another, fostering a more inclusive environment.

Other options like time sharing, respect, and harassment do not encapsulate the concept of different cultural groups coming together in a shared activity. Time sharing relates to the allocation of time resources, respect concerns individual attitudes towards others, and harassment involves inappropriate or harmful behavior towards individuals. In contrast, cultural diversity is explicitly focused on the coexistence and interaction of multiple cultures within a shared setting.
